Tailwind CSS

Tailwind CSS: What It Is, Why Use It & Examples

CSS

Introduction:

Tail windcss has become a cornerstone in modern web development, offering a unique and powerful approach to styling. In this comprehensive guide, we will unravel the mysteries behind Tailwind CSS, understanding what makes it stand out, the reasons for its widespread adoption, and how it can be effectively employed in your projects. Join us on this journey to discover the ins and outs of Tailwind CSS, complete with insightful examples.

Learn More About Vingsfire:-

1.LINKEDIN

2.FACEBOOK

3.INSTAGRAM

What is Tailwind CSS?

Tail windcss is a utility-first CSS framework that takes a distinctive approach to styling web applications. Unlike conventional frameworks that provide pre-designed components and styles, Tailwind focuses on offering a set of low-level utility classes, enabling developers to build designs directly within their markup. This utility-first philosophy means that each class corresponds to a specific styling utility, allowing for unparalleled customization and flexibility.

Why Use Tailwind CSS?

Flexibility and Customization:

Tail windcss empowers developers to create highly customized designs by composing utility classes. This approach facilitates rapid iteration and customization without the need for extensive custom CSS. This level of flexibility is particularly beneficial for projects with unique design requirements.

Developer Productivity:

The extensive set of utility classes in Tailwind significantly reduces the need for writing custom CSS. This not only accelerates development but also promotes consistency across projects, making it easier for teams to maintain a unified design language.

Responsive Design:

Tail windcss simplifies the creation of responsive designs with its built-in responsive utility classes. Developers can effortlessly apply different styles based on screen sizes, ensuring a seamless user experience on various devices.

Optimized Build Process:

Tail windcss build process is optimized for production, eliminating unused styles and minimizing the final CSS file size. This leads to faster loading times, contributing to an enhanced user experience and improved website performance.

Examples of Tailwind CSS in Action:

Basic Styling:
Applying text and background colors, font sizes, and spacing with Tailwind classes.

Flexbox and Grid Layouts:
Leveraging Tailwind classes to create flexible and responsive layouts using Flexbox and CSS Grid.

Responsive Design:
Implementing responsive design by utilizing Tailwind’s responsive utility classes for various screen sizes.

Custom Components:
Building custom components with Tailwind classes, showcasing the framework’s adaptability to unique design requirements.

Conclusion:

Tailwind CSS stands as a revolutionary force in the realm of web development, offering a utility-first approach that prioritizes customization, developer productivity, and optimized build processes. Armed with a deeper understanding of Tailwind CSS and practical examples, you are now equipped to integrate this powerful framework into your projects, unlocking its full potential for efficient and visually appealing web designs.

Leave a Reply

Your email address will not be published. Required fields are marked *